Output 81eab4acc0882ee0677fb2fd5ef702ce25376cd2e19626716e442e8a1d10d2af: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b189c4a621a4012311ebd1793fd0c03f70129e OP_EQUAL
address
3PMpkaJRF5xbM2837HKrxM9ToQe67XnR44
transaction
81eab4acc0882ee0677fb2fd5ef702ce25376cd2e19626716e442e8a1d10d2af
spent
true